Harris spends little time on the successes and failures of Soviet socialism, she says, but neither does she merely explore the lifestyles of women in the post-Soviet Central Asian country. Rather, she inquires into the exercise of social control, and how this has been turned back on itself, resisted, evaded, and suborned by both women and men. Her pivots are the nature of the gendered power relations that produce and enable domination and their function within the various layers of social relations, the formation of human identity, and how her subjects form their gender identities and the significance of these for social control.
